Undergraduate Research, Scholarly and Creative Activities



2005 URS presenter The opportunity to expand the body of knowledge in a field by participating in scholarly research or creative activity is a hallmark of superior undergraduate institutions.

UMM provides numerous opportunities for students to make such contributions on campus, within the larger university, and beyond our borders.

Faculty from all disciplines are pleased to discuss research and creative opportunities with students, as are students' advisers.

Scholarships and funding
Scholarships, awards and financial assistance for UMM students participating in research or creative activity include the Morris Academic Partnership stipend (MAP), the Undergraduate Research Opportunity Program (UROP), the Bos Research Fund, the Tate Memorial Fund, and more.
